TITLE:  Set up domain search capabilities with reduced bandwidth
consumption
This tip was submitted by The VIEW's Cheryl Elmo and Debbie Lynd.

To reduce network bandwidth consumption during domain searches, you
may want to set up regional Domain Search servers: North American
Domain Search on server A; Latin American Domain Search Server on
server B, etc. The databases indexed on each server can be specific
to the region so that users go to a single server in their region to
conduct searches.  

To decide who uses which server to search, you can create user
profiles that will update the user's current Location document with
the appropriate Domain Search server (i.e.,
USDomainSearch/Server/View and UKDomainSearch/Server/View).
